From 45f521f6e21cd8ee01afa522b8fe3b3a7736fa7e Mon Sep 17 00:00:00 2001 From: erik Date: Sun, 7 Oct 2007 18:49:11 +0000 Subject: modtasten von martin git-svn-id: https://svn.neo-layout.org@298 b9310e46-f624-0410-8ea1-cfbb3a30dc96 --- grafik/mod-tasten/README.txt | 1 + grafik/mod-tasten/compose.png | Bin 0 -> 36183 bytes grafik/mod-tasten/compose.svg | 825 ++++++++++++++++++++++++++++++++++++++++ linux/X/Weiteres/de | 15 +- linux/X/Weiteres/neo_de.xmodmap | 12 +- 5 files changed, 840 insertions(+), 13 deletions(-) create mode 100644 grafik/mod-tasten/README.txt create mode 100644 grafik/mod-tasten/compose.png create mode 100644 grafik/mod-tasten/compose.svg diff --git a/grafik/mod-tasten/README.txt b/grafik/mod-tasten/README.txt new file mode 100644 index 0000000..8f96af4 --- /dev/null +++ b/grafik/mod-tasten/README.txt @@ -0,0 +1 @@ +Vorschläge von Martin für die Mod-Tasten und für Kombi/Compose. diff --git a/grafik/mod-tasten/compose.png b/grafik/mod-tasten/compose.png new file mode 100644 index 0000000..d9648fe Binary files /dev/null and b/grafik/mod-tasten/compose.png differ diff --git a/grafik/mod-tasten/compose.svg b/grafik/mod-tasten/compose.svg new file mode 100644 index 0000000..9c7e297 --- /dev/null +++ b/grafik/mod-tasten/compose.svg @@ -0,0 +1,825 @@ + + + + + + + + + image/svg+xml +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+ mod3 + + Shift + + mod5 + + + + + + a + + e + + a + e + + + + + + + + + + + + + + + + mod3 + + + Compose + &mod5 + + + + + + + + + + + d + D + : + δ + , + Δ + + + + + + + + + + + + y + Y + + υ + þ + Þ + + + https://neo.eigenheimstrasse.de/svn/grafik/xmodmap2tastenaufkleber/tastaturbilder/ + + + Compose + + + + + + a + + e + + a + e + + + &mod5 + + + + + diff --git a/linux/X/Weiteres/de b/linux/X/Weiteres/de index 065e407..eaf5fbd 100644 --- a/linux/X/Weiteres/de +++ b/linux/X/Weiteres/de @@ -202,19 +202,19 @@ xkb_symbols "sundeadkeys" { // Other Questions: // neo_layout (at) yahoogroups (dot) de -partial alphanumeric_keys +partial alphanumeric_keys modifier_keys keypad_keys xkb_symbols "neo" { name[Group1]= "German Neostyle"; - key.type[Group1]="EIGHT_LEVEL_ALPHABETIC"; + key.type[Group1]="EIGHT_LEVEL_SEMIALPHABETIC"; // 1st row // eigentlich sollte die folgende Zeile rein, aber auf älteren Systemen ist der // dead_stroke noch nicht definiert key { [ dead_circumflex, dead_caron, dead_breve, dead_stroke ] }; - //key { [ dead_circumflex, dead_caron, dead_breve dead_breve, dead_belowdot, dead_belowdot ] }; + //key { [ dead_circumflex, dead_caron, dead_breve, dead_breve, dead_belowdot, dead_belowdot ] }; key { [ 1, degree, onesuperior, U2640, enfilledcircbullet ] }; key { [ 2, numerosign, twosuperior, U26A5, U2023 ] }; @@ -271,11 +271,12 @@ xkb_symbols "neo" { key { [ space, space, space, nobreakspace, 0, U202F ] }; // new modkeys + key.type[Group1]="EIGHT_LEVEL" ; - key { [ ISO_Level3_Shift, ISO_Level3_Shift, Caps_Lock, Caps_Lock, Caps_Lock, Caps_Lock ] }; - key { [ ISO_Level3_Shift, ISO_Level3_Shift, Multi_key, Multi_key, Multi_key, Multi_key ] }; - key { [ 0xfe11, 0xfe11, Multi_key, Multi_key ] }; - key { [ 0xfe11, 0xfe11, Multi_key, Multi_key, KP_Decimal, 0xfe11 ] }; + key { [ ISO_Level3_Shift, ISO_Level3_Shift, Caps_Lock, Caps_Lock, Multi_key, Multi_key ] }; + key { [ ISO_Level3_Shift, ISO_Level3_Shift, Caps_Lock, Caps_Lock, Multi_key, Multi_key ] }; + key { [ 0xfe11, 0xfe11, Multi_key, Multi_key Caps_Lock Caps_Lock ] }; + key { [ 0xfe11, 0xfe11, Multi_key, Multi_key, KP_Decimal, Caps_Lock ] }; modifier_map mod5 { , }; // Keypad diff --git a/linux/X/Weiteres/neo_de.xmodmap b/linux/X/Weiteres/neo_de.xmodmap index fd175b1..9ffd54e 100644 --- a/linux/X/Weiteres/neo_de.xmodmap +++ b/linux/X/Weiteres/neo_de.xmodmap @@ -87,10 +87,10 @@ keycode 61 = j J semicolon U3D1 period nabla ! Make CapsLock an additional Alt_Gr (Mode_switch is for 3rd and 4th level) remove Lock = Caps_Lock remove Mod3 = ISO_Level3_Shift -keycode 66 = Mode_switch Mode_switch Caps_Lock Caps_Lock Multi_key Multi_key -! Make AltGr and apostrophe to Mode_switch (which is the 3rd and 4th level) -keycode 113 = ISO_Level3_Shift ISO_Level3_Shift Multi_key Multi_key KP_Decimal +! Make former CapsLock and qwertz-# to Mode_switch (which is the 3rd and 4th level) +keycode 66 = Mode_switch Mode_switch Caps_Lock Caps_Lock Multi_key Multi_key +keycode 51 = Mode_switch Mode_switch Caps_Lock Caps_Lock Multi_key Multi_key !keycode 48 = Mode_switch Mode_switch U133 U132 schwa SCHWA add Mod5 = Mode_switch @@ -99,9 +99,9 @@ add Mod5 = Mode_switch ! the right win key modifies the 5th and 6th !keycode 116 = ISO_Level3_Shift -! Make the former qwertz-# and qwertz-< to Mod5 (ISO_Level3_Shift) -keycode 51 = Mode_switch Mode_switch Caps_Lock Caps_Lock Multi_key Multi_key -keycode 94 = ISO_Level3_Shift ISO_Level3_Shift Multi_key Multi_key +! Make the former AltGr and qwertz-< to Mod5 (ISO_Level3_Shift) +keycode 94 = ISO_Level3_Shift ISO_Level3_Shift Multi_key Multi_key Caps_Lock Caps_Lock +keycode 113 = ISO_Level3_Shift ISO_Level3_Shift Multi_key Multi_key KP_Decimal Caps_Lock add Mod3 = ISO_Level3_Shift ! force to learn the new Escape! -- cgit v1.2.3